TS-Nano Sealants
Grant in 2025
TS-Nano Sealants is a service-oriented company specializing in the design, manufacture, and application of polymer nanocomposite sealants. The company's patented technology focuses on subsurface sealing to reduce methane and CO2 emissions, contributing to climate change mitigation. TS-Nano Sealants offers a comprehensive range of services, including design, manufacturing, supply, and field engineering, to ensure effective application of their products. The sealants are engineered for high durability and penetration, allowing them to perform effectively under various temperature, pressure, and chemical exposure conditions, thereby helping clients to address and prevent challenging leaks.
E3 Lithium is a resource company based in Alberta, focused on the development of lithium extraction technology from brines. The company is actively exploring its mineral properties, particularly the Clearwater project, which is situated in the Leduc Reservoir of south-central Alberta. E3 Lithium's assets are organized into five sub-properties: Clearwater, Exshaw, Rocky, Sunbreaker, and Drumheller. Leveraging the expertise of the mature oil and gas industry in the region, E3 Lithium aims to accelerate its development and contribute to the growing demand for lithium in the electrical revolution.

NuVista Energy
Grant in 2024
NuVista Energy Ltd. is a Calgary-based company engaged in the exploration, development, and production of condensate, oil, and natural gas reserves within the Western Canadian Sedimentary Basin. The company primarily focuses on the condensate-rich Montney formation located in the Wapiti area of the Alberta Deep Basin. Established in 2003, NuVista has transformed its operations by emphasizing the development of its valuable Wapiti Montney play, which significantly contributes to its hydrocarbon production. Condensate, which constitutes nearly half of the company's sales, plays a crucial role in the heavy oil industry by enhancing the viscosity required for pipeline transportation. To support its production capabilities, NuVista operates compressor and dehydration stations, further optimizing its service assets in the region. The company has also made strides in financial management, reducing long-term debt substantially, which allows for continued investment in its core operations and growth opportunities.
Thiozen is a company based in Belmont, Massachusetts, founded in 2020, that specializes in innovative hydrogen gas production technology aimed at reducing greenhouse gas emissions. The company has developed a unique chemical process that converts hydrogen sulfide into hydrogen gas. This approach allows clients to sidestep the carbon emissions typically associated with hydrogen production from natural gas, as well as the high costs linked to electrolysis methods. By providing a low-cost and low-emission alternative for hydrogen production from sour gases, Thiozen positions itself as a key player in the decarbonization of the energy sector.
Northstar Clean Technologies
Grant in 2024
Northstar Clean Technologies, established in 2017 and headquartered in Delta, British Columbia, specializes in the recycling of single-use asphalt shingles. The company employs proprietary process technology to extract and recover valuable components such as asphalt cement, fiberglass, and mineral aggregates. These recovered materials are then repurposed for use in asphalt pavement, shingle manufacturing, and various construction products, contributing to environmentally-friendly reprocessing solutions. Operating primarily within Canada, Northstar Clean Technologies is dedicated to promoting sustainability in the construction and industrial sectors through its innovative recycling efforts.

Litus
Pre Seed Round in 2022
Litus is a company focused on developing innovative nanotechnology and chemical processing solutions aimed at enhancing the efficiency and sustainability of lithium production. The company specializes in a patented method for selectively extracting lithium from aqueous sources, ensuring the preservation of source water and minimizing contamination. By producing high-purity lithium compounds, Litus enables its customers and partners to create energy systems that are not only abundant and accessible but also environmentally friendly. The company's commitment to clean and efficient production processes positions it as a key player in addressing contemporary energy challenges.

Seppure Technologies
Grant in 2021
Seppure Technologies is focused on transforming the energy-intensive processes of chemical separation and purification utilized across various industries. The company has developed innovative chemical-resistant nanofiltration membranes that replace traditional methods such as distillation and evaporation. By implementing this sustainable technology, Seppure enables clients to significantly reduce their energy consumption, emissions, and pollution. This approach not only enhances the efficiency of industrial-scale chemical separations but also contributes to a more environmentally friendly manufacturing landscape.
Enersion is a research and development company focused on creating innovative solutions for cooling, heating, and electricity. The company specializes in the design of adsorption chillers that utilize nano-porous materials to convert waste heat into cooling, thereby eliminating the need for electrically powered compressors or synthetic refrigerants. Enersion's Tri-Generation technology enhances energy efficiency by converting waste heat from power generation into cooling, maximizing savings for clients. By using natural gas for efficient cooling and generating electricity from hot water, Enersion enables clients to access sustainable energy solutions at reduced costs, benefiting both the environment and their operational expenses.
Mangrove Water Technologies
Grant in 2019
Mangrove Water Technologies Ltd. is a Vancouver-based company established in 2017, specializing in wastewater desalination systems. The company has developed a modular and mobile technology that effectively treats and purifies contaminated well water, converting saline wastewater and waste gases into desalinated water and value-added chemicals for on-site use. This innovative technology has progressed from a laboratory concept to a commercial-scale demonstration over four years, reflecting significant advancements in its capabilities. The technology originated from research conducted at the University of British Columbia's Chemical Engineering Department, with support from various funding sources aimed at reducing emissions and promoting economic development.
Fractal Systems
Grant in 2019
Fractal Systems Inc. is a technology company specializing in heavy oil solutions, focusing on enhancing producer margins, streamlining infrastructure, and facilitating the transportation of heavy oil and bitumen. Established in 2006 and headquartered in Sherbrooke, Canada, with additional offices in Calgary, the company develops, patents, and implements innovative technologies. One of its key offerings is JetShear, a suite of technologies designed to improve the quality of bitumen products and reduce their viscosity, thereby allowing processed fluids to flow more easily through transport pipelines. Fractal Systems aims to provide cost-effective solutions that address the challenges associated with heavy oil production and transportation.
Ground Effects Environmental Services
Grant in 2017
Ground Effects Environmental Services (GEE), established in 1998 and headquartered in Regina, Saskatchewan, specializes in innovative environmental solutions for various industries, including oil and gas, mining, and industrial sectors. The company has developed over 70 patented in situ remediation technologies, focusing particularly on mobile remediation solutions and electrokinetic technologies. GEE's proprietary electrokinetic platform effectively removes solids and contaminants from fluids, supporting applications such as frac flowback treatment, salt remediation, drill cuttings treatment, and invert drilling mud treatment. Additionally, Ground Effects provides bio-decontamination units designed to eliminate viruses and bacteria from surfaces, positioning itself as a leader in the field of environmental services.

SewerVUE specializes in advanced underground pipe inspection technology utilizing a multi-sensor system to evaluate pipe infrastructure. The company's innovative solution features a remotely operated robot that integrates CCTV data with ground penetrating radar (GPR) measurements, allowing for precise quantification of remaining pipe wall thickness. Additionally, the system includes a floating platform equipped with LiDAR, sonar, and sophisticated analysis software, enabling clients to accurately model the inner surfaces of pipes and assess conditions such as deformation and corrosion. This comprehensive approach enhances the ability to monitor and maintain vital underground utilities.

Acceleware Ltd. is a Canadian clean-tech company focused on developing innovative technologies for the oil and gas sector, specifically in heavy oil and oil sands production. The company operates through two main segments: Radio Frequency (RF) Heating and High-Performance Computing (HPC). Acceleware's RF Heating technology, known as RF XL, is designed to provide a low-cost, low-carbon solution for oil extraction that minimizes environmental impact, eliminates greenhouse gas emissions, and does not require water or solvents. The HPC segment offers advanced computational software solutions, including tools for electromagnetic modeling and seismic imaging, which enhance oil exploration and reservoir characterization. Founded in 2004 and headquartered in Calgary, Acceleware aims to support a transition towards cleaner energy production while improving economic performance in the energy sector. The company collaborates with Indigenous groups to promote sustainable practices that respect land and water.

Quantiam Technologies
Grant in 2014
Quantiam Technologies, Inc. is a manufacturing technology company headquartered in Edmonton, Canada, specializing in the development and commercialization of advanced materials, catalysts, coatings, and surfaces designed for extreme-operating environments and energy-related applications. The company offers high-performance coatings for the internal surfaces of complex shapes, such as tubulars, with a significant production capacity. Its product range serves various industries, including aerospace, automotive, mining, chemical processing, and the cleantech sector, focusing on reducing energy consumption and emissions. Quantiam also develops catalyst systems and nanomaterials, particularly for the methanol-hydrogen economy, and provides technical services related to nanomaterials characterization, surface analysis, and materials performance. Founded in 1998, Quantiam Technologies aims to deliver innovative solutions that enhance operational efficiency and sustainability across multiple sectors.
Liquid Light
Grant in 2014
Liquid Light Corporation is a Monmouth Junction, New Jersey-based company that specializes in developing and licensing innovative technology for converting carbon dioxide (CO2) into valuable chemicals and fuels. Founded in 2008, the company utilizes a low-energy catalytic electrochemistry process to efficiently transform CO2 into multi-carbon chemicals, such as ethylene glycol. This patent-pending electrocatalytic platform allows for the use of low-cost inputs and promotes long-term pricing stability, enabling industries to turn an environmental waste into a profitable resource. By harnessing its technology, Liquid Light aims to help customers lower production costs, reduce reliance on volatile petroleum feedstocks, and minimize their carbon footprint, thereby contributing to more sustainable industrial practices.

Carbon Engineering
Grant in 2012
Carbon Engineering Ltd. is a clean energy company based in Squamish, Canada, that specializes in the development and commercialization of Direct Air Capture technology. Founded in 2009, the company focuses on capturing carbon dioxide (CO2) directly from the atmosphere, which allows for the management of emissions from a variety of distributed and mobile sources, including vehicles and buildings. Its innovative chemical-based CO2 air capture system integrates processes such as an air contactor and a regeneration cycle, enabling continuous capture and production of pure CO2. Carbon Engineering aims to convert captured CO2 into clean, affordable transportation fuels, addressing the global climate challenge by facilitating the deployment of its technology to help businesses reduce their carbon footprint and achieve net-zero targets.
